How much does it cost to rent a home in Eastover?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Eastover 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,102 | $525 | $1,500 |
Eastover 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,456 | $575 | $2,495 |
Eastover 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,025 | $1,600 | $2,300 |
Eastover 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,250 | $2,250 | $2,250 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Eastover
What type of rentals are currently available in Eastover?
There are currently 33 Apartments for Rent in Eastover, NC with pricing that ranges from $752 to $2,662. There are also 33 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Eastover ranging from $525 to $2,495.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Eastover?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Eastover ranges from $525 to $2,495 with an average monthly rent of $1,499.
